It's pretty incredible how well the limited edition of Persona 5 is doing considering the high price ($135 USD). In terms of revenue the game will be even better than Persona 4 since the latter didn't receive a nationwide limited edition (but there was a limited edition at Konamistyle for ¥9,200). Also the regular edition of Persona 5 (¥7,800) is priced higher than Persona 4 (¥6,600). It wouldn't even need to outsell Persona 4 to gross much more. Though I would assume the budget for Persona 5 is much higher.
